I copy-pasted the above block from the book's Firefox window to this
Firefox window, so I know that works. However, I cannot copy from or paste
to either the terminal window or XEdit.
I have tried:
click-drag selecting and then right-clicking;
Try click-drag selecting and then *middle button* clicking on the terminal
window or XEdit.
If your mouse has only 2 buttons, try clicking *both* of them at the same
time - that's called "3-button-emulation".
If you're in a CLI (read: text only mode) make sure 'gpm' is running so you
have mouse access to the text screen, then the middle-button-click works in
lynx as well.
